Comfortable, tight across top front By Knotty Toe Dave from Springfield, VA on 07/05/2009 Pros: Comfortable, Lightweight, Stable Describe Yourself: Comfort Driven Sizing: Feels true to size Bottom Line: Yes, I would recommend this to a friend Comments: I wear these with jeans and with khakis to work (the office is casual). They look quite good with both. The style, though plain, is quite atractive. I have a history of good luck with New Balance and Dunham shoes. The one problem I have with these is tightness across the top of my right foot, but I broke a toe as a child and have a small rise there. The inflexibility of this shoe is causing pain, but that's not unusual for me in shoes. Since the left feels fine, I'll keep this and gradually break in the right one. The point is, they are stiff and firm out of the box. Because of that, the heel fit is excellent with no slipping. The shoe's also sturdy, almost like a cross-trainer in its stability.
